Frequently Asked Questions

How do I check if a clothing brand name is available?
Check domain name availability (.com preferred), social media handles, and conduct a preliminary trademark search on the USPTO's TESS database. Consult a legal professional for comprehensive clearance before committing.
What is the difference between a brand name and a collection name?
A brand name is the overall company identity (e.g., 'Nike'), while a collection name refers to a specific product line or season (e.g., 'Nike Air Max'). Your brand name is what you legally form your business under.
Do I need a DBA if I form an LLC?
You only need a DBA if you want your LLC to operate under a name different from its official registered LLC name. For example, 'MyBrand LLC' operating as 'Stylish Boutique.'
How much does it cost to form an LLC for a clothing brand?
LLC formation costs vary by state, ranging from $50 to $500+ for initial filing fees. Many states also have annual fees, like California's $800 minimum franchise tax.
Can I use a foreign language for my clothing brand name?
Yes, you can use foreign language words, but ensure they are easily pronounceable, have positive connotations, and do not infringe on existing trademarks. Check meanings carefully.
